Bansjori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Bansjori Village has a population of 2.53 k (2,529) with 1.22 k (1,220) males and 1.31 k (1,309) females.The sex ratio in Bansjori is 1073,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Bansjori Village is 433 (433) which is 17.12% of Bansjori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Bansjori Village is 1082 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Bansjori village is listed as part of the Sundarpahari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Godda District in the state of JHARKHAND in INDIA.

Bansjori Literacy Rate
Bansjori Village has a literacy rate of 46.09%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Bansjori Village is 60.77 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Bansjori Village is 32.38 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Bansjori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Bansjori Village is 33 (33) with 11 (11) males and 22 (22) females, which is 1.3% of Bansjori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 2000 females for every 1000 males.
Bansjori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Bansjori Village is 1.02 k (1,024) with 492 (492) males and 532 (532) females, which is 40.49% of Bansjori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1082 females for every 1000 males.

Bansjori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Bansjori Village, there are about 1.32 k (1,323) workers, making up nearly 52.31% of the Bansjori Village total population. Out of these, around 701 (701) are male workers, and about 622 (622) are female workers.
